Description

Boom is a fitness tracker that focuses specifically on young children grades kindergarten through 3rd grade. Boom tracks the children’s activity level each day. To make this fun, Boom incorporates a monkey named Boom as a way to provide companionship to the users so they feel as if they have a buddy at all times. The more active the user is the more intense Boom’s actives will be. From Boom walking to multiple back flips making it a competitive and goal setting activity each day while enforcing healthy habits.

Mission

Be the leading product to enable and instill healthy habits at a young age.

Vision

Improve the well being of young lives by preventing childhood obesity.
